Do parents or relatives lose custody of their children?

Not if they continue showing interest in their child/children's needs

Can parents or relatives visit their child/children?

Yes, they can go out or receive visits on weekends.

Do parents or relatives need to pay?

Sacred Heart Children's Home accepts only low-income families that are asked to help according to their possibilities. 

Which schools do children attend?

Children at Sacred Heart attend different L.I.S.D. Schools

Who takes care of the children while at Sacred Heart Children's Home?

The Religious Sisters Servants of the Sacred Heart of Jesus and of the Poor

Sacred Heart Children's Home provides a holistic care with corporal, spiritual, and educational opportunities to children who for some justified reason cannot stay at home with their families. What are those justifiable reasons?

Children who have lost one or both parents by death or divorce

Children whose relatives feel that they cannot take care of them properly

Children whose parents income cannot provide for the child's needs

Children who due to illness in the family cannot remain at home

Children who have been abused, neglected, or rejected
